Question

what is unleaded petrol?

The petrol containing lead compounds (principally tetra ethyl lead or TEL) is known as leaded petrol. Tetraethyl lead was added to petrol as an antiknocking agent to enhance the performance of the vehicle. However, the exhaust from such vehicles was found to contain lead. Lead is a very toxic metal that causes damage to the central nervous system.

Unleaded petrol is petrol in which this anti-knocking substance is not added that is the petrol that has been not been treated with the lead compounds is called unleaded petrol. Unleaded petrol does not release lead compounds to the atmosphere from exhaust fumes and causes less pollution.
